Have you ever looked through a small telescope and thought, "That's cool," but wondered if you could do more than just gaze at faint blobs? You absolutely can. Based on the principles in Michael Gainer’s book, Real Astronomy with Small Telescopes , even a modest 80mm refractor or 90mm Maksutov-Cassegrain can be used as a serious scientific instrument.
